  15. 'We have to be proud'published at 20:59 Greenwich Mean Time 16 February 2023

    FT: Barcelona 2-2 Man Utd

    Barcelona

    Barcelona manager Xavi speaking to BT Sport: "It was a really tough game, really difficult with a lot of intensity, passion, and rhythm. I think we have to be proud because we competed really well until the end. We could have won in the last two chances but we played today against a top team in Europe. I think Manchester United is coming back and today they showed the best version. We competed really well, we need to be proud. Now we need to compete well in Old Trafford."

    "I think both teams are more or less in the same moment, in the same position that we are coming back. I say to Erik Ten Hag congratulations because his is doing very well, but they are Manchester United. Yes it can be a final, or semi-final or quarter-final in the future of Champions League but now we are in Europa League, we are coming back and today we show a very good performance from both teams."

    On Raphinha's reaction to being substituted: "That is normal, this is football. I say to the players that they have to be angry. That's normal, it is football. The problem is when they don't have attitude on the pitch and the attitude of Raphinha is amazing."

  16. 'It feels like a loss'published at 20:55 Greenwich Mean Time 16 February 2023

    FT: Barcelona 2-2 Man Utd

    Manchester United

    Manchester United goal scorer Marcus Rashford speaking to BT Sport: "It feels like a loss. I think we did well to get back into the game, the first-half was probably in favour of them but I think we stayed calm and tried to create chances when we could. We scored two good goal and tried to maintain control of the outcome but they are a good team.

    "I felt we were trying to score more goals in the second-half, that may have been because we were a goal behind."

    On his goal: "It is difficult to find a finish from there but i made my mind up and tried to get as clean a contact as I could and it went in."

    On Barcelona's equaliser: "I think you have to expect them to they have got a lot of top players and if you give them time on the ball they are going to find gaps."

    On whether he was fouled: "It is a massive moment in the game and I have not watched it back but in the moment I don't get why he thinks I am going down there. I have touched it passed him and there is clear contact, it is not a penalty but it is 100 percent a foul."

    On the return leg: "Hopefully it will be another good game but we will go that one step further."
